A two double bedroom with large gardens close to shops, schools, beaches and much more. Located on the edge of St Austell town centre.

The Property And Location - Located on the outskirts of St. Austell town centre but within walking distance of many everyday amenities and transport services is this delightful two-bedroom terrace house.

The former three bedroom home offers ground floor accommodation comprising a beautifully presented living room with a sylvan feel to the front view and views over the garden to the rear. A spacious kitchen/diner that could be in need of some updating and has a handy utility room off to one side. To the first floor you have the two double bedrooms and a shower room that has space to make a full bathroom and shower room. The landing has been turned into a lovely office area with views over the back garden.

One of the standout features of this home is the large garden, providing a great area for families or an equally great area that would suit those looking to grow their own veg at home. There are also lower maintenance front gardens that are bordered by beautiful mature trees.

Situated in the Polkyth area of St. Austell, residents of this wonderful home enjoy the convenience of nearby amenities, including shops, schools, leisure facilities and a mainline train station all within walking distance. The town's picturesque surroundings provide an abundance of natural beauty, with stunning coastal landscapes and scenic countryside waiting to be explored. This enclose the historic port of Charlestown, ever popular Carlyon Bay, Pentewen beach and woodland walks and of course the vast array of clay walks that you can follow to Luxulyan and The Eden Project

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
